android monkey测试工具 Android Monkey测试工具的详细介绍及使用方法
Android Monkey是一种用于测试Android应用程序稳定性和可靠性的工具。它可以模拟用户对应用程序进行随机操作,如点击、滑动、输入等,以检测应用程序是否存在潜在的崩溃或异常行为。
Android Monkey的主要功能包括:
1. 随机操作: Android Monkey可以生成随机的用户操作序列,包括点击、滑动、输入等,在测试过程中模拟真实用户的操作行为。
2. 异常检测: Android Monkey可以监测应用程序是否发生崩溃、无响应或异常行为,并生成相应的报告,方便开发人员定位和修复问题。
3. 自定义参数: Android Monkey还支持自定义参数设置,如操作频率、事件类型、测试时间等,以满足不同测试需求。
使用Android Monkey进行应用程序测试的示例:
假设我们有一个名为"Calculator"的计算器应用程序,我们希望测试其稳定性和可靠性。以下是使用Android Monkey进行测试的步骤和示例代码:
1. 安装Android SDK并配置环境变量。
2. 在命令行中输入以下命令,以启动Monkey测试:
```
adb shell monkey -p -v 500
```
- `-p`参数指定要测试的应用程序包名。
- `-v`参数表示详细模式,将输出更详细的测试结果。
3. Monkey测试将自动生成随机的用户操作序列,并在应用程序中执行。
4. 在测试完成后,可以通过以下命令导出测试结果:
```
adb shell monkey --kill-process-after-error -p -v 500 > test_result.txt
```
- `--kill-process-after-error`参数表示在发生错误后终止测试。
- `> test_result.txt`将测试结果输出到文本文件中。
通过查看测试结果,开发人员可以快速定位应用程序的问题,并进行修复改进。
总结:
本文介绍了Android Monkey测试工具的功能和使用方法,并提供了一个使用示例。通过使用Android Monkey进行应用程序测试,开发人员可以更好地评估应用程序的稳定性和可靠性,提高应用程序的质量和用户体验。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。